Welcome to CMIF

The Cellular and Molecular Imaging Facility at North Carolina State University is located in the Department of Plant Biology (4115 Gardner Hall), and is directed by Dr. Nina Strömgren Allen. The facility contains a number of state-of-the-art microscopes which were obtained with funding from the North Carolina Biotechnology Center, National Aeronautics and Space Administration (part of the NSCORT program), National Science Foundation, McKnight Foundation, NCARS from NC State and NC State Research Committee. The facility policy is an open one, but we give preference for usage time to faculty members who were involved in writing the various grants. The facility has a senior research associate, Dr. Eva Johannes, available to help instruct and carry out research involving any of the available instrumentation.
